Learning Chinese Word: 咖啡厅

Understanding "咖啡厅" - Chinese Word Explanation


1. Basic Information

  • Word: 咖啡厅
  • Pinyin: kā fēi tīng
  • Literal Meaning: "coffee hall" or "coffee room"
  • Primary Meaning: A café or coffee shop; a place where people drink coffee, socialize, or work.

2. In-depth Explanation

Context and Usage

"咖啡厅" (kā fēi tīng) refers to a café or coffee shop, similar to Western-style coffeehouses. It is a common term used in urban areas of China, where such establishments are popular for socializing, working, or relaxing. Unlike "咖啡馆" (kā fēi guǎn), which can sometimes imply a more traditional or smaller café, "咖啡厅" often suggests a slightly more modern or spacious setting.

Character Breakdown

  • 咖啡 (kā fēi): Means "coffee."
  • 咖 (kā): Part of the transliteration for "coffee."
  • 啡 (fēi): Another part of the transliteration for "coffee."
  • 厅 (tīng): Means "hall" or "room," often referring to a public or semi-public space.

Together, the term literally means a "coffee hall," emphasizing the social or communal aspect of the space.


3. Example Sentences

  1. Chinese: 我们明天在咖啡厅见面吧。
    Pinyin: Wǒmen míngtiān zài kāfēitīng jiànmiàn ba.
    English: Let’s meet at the café tomorrow.

  2. Chinese: 这家咖啡厅的拿铁很好喝。
    Pinyin: Zhè jiā kāfēitīng de nǎtiě hěn hǎohē.
    English: The latte at this café is very delicious.

  3. Chinese: 他喜欢在咖啡厅里工作。
    Pinyin: Tā xǐhuān zài kāfēitīng lǐ gōngzuò.
    English: He likes to work in the coffee shop.


Cultural Notes

In China, "咖啡厅" (kā fēi tīng) is not just a place to drink coffee but also a popular spot for meetings, studying, or casual hangouts. Many coffee shops in China, like Starbucks or local chains, are designed with comfortable seating and free Wi-Fi, catering to students and professionals. The rise of café culture in China reflects the influence of Western lifestyles, especially among younger generations.
